342 MARYLAND COURT OF APPEALS

Court or Terrae Mr Daniel Dulany Attorney for the Plantiff offers himself
ready to prosecute this Cause And that in as much as by the Act for Limita-
tion of Actions this Cause cannot be continued untill the next Court he
moves for Judgmt by default unless tryall this Court.

Whereupon the said James Frisby altho Solemnly call'd comes not but
makes Default whereby the said John Snow remaines against the said James
Frisby without further defence.

Therefore it is Considered by the Justices here the 13th day of October
Anno Domi: 1719 afd That the said John Snow recover against the said James
Frisby as well the sum of five hundred pounds Sterling his damages by Occa-
sion of the premisses afd as also the sum of nine hundred and Sixty one pounds
of Tobacco by the Court here Adjudged unto him for his Costs and Charges
by him about his suit in this behalf laid out and Expended and the Deft in
Mercy etc.

In testimony that the aforegoing is a true Coppy taken from the Pro-
ceedings of the Provinciall of Maryland the seale of the same Court is here-
unto Affixt this i8th day of April 1721

[Provinciall Seale] per Vachel Denton Clk
[525] Afterwards to Witt on the twentyth day of April Anno Domi Seven-
teen hundred and twenty One in the same Writt mentioned Comes here into
Court the afsd Ariana Frisby Exr* afd by Thos Bordley her Attorney and says
that in the Records and process afsd and also in the Rendering the Judgm1
afsd it is manifestly Erred. In this to witt that the said James Frisby deced
was Summonsed to render the said John an Account of the time he was
bailiff of the said John and receiver of his goods etc: And yet the said John
in his Declaration against the said James shews not that ever the said James
was bayliff of the said John but receiver only and in that the said Declaration
is Insufficient and wants form

Also in this that the Judgmt is rendred against the Said James that he
render Account of the time he was Bayliff of the said John and receiver of
the Goods etc: but not that he render Account of the said Goods so that there
is no Judgmt to Account for the goods for which he Declares but Judgmt to
Account as Bayliff on which the said John Declares not.

Also in this that altho, it appears the Auditers were as well appointed
by Consent of both parties as by the Court and that they intirely exonerated
the said James on his Account upon Oath According to the Usage and prac-
tice of this Province and the Courts of Judicature therein yet that Judgment
was rendred that the said John should recover against the said James whereas
it Ought to have been that the said James should go thereof without day.
